Greek Yogurt & Berry Parfait

Greek Yogurt & Berry Parfait

By Sharon Matuck

Total: 15 minutes
BreakfastDessertVegetarian

Ingredients

  • 3 cups plain Greek yogurt
  • 1 1/2 cups m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ries)
  • 1 cup soy-free granola or oats + nuts mix
  • 3 tbsp honey
  • 3 tbsp chia seeds (optional)

Instructions

1

Wash the mixed berries thoroughly under cold water and drain them well. Remove any stems from the strawberries and cut them into halves or quarters, depending on their size.

2

In a small bowl, mix the honey with the plain Greek yogurt until well combined. If you're using chia seeds, stir them into the yogurt mixture now to allow them to start absorbing the liquid and expand.

3

Spoon a layer of the yogurt mixture into the bottom of 4 serving glasses or bowls.

4

Add a layer of the mixed berries over the yogurt, distributing them evenly among the glasses or bowls.

5

Sprinkle a layer of soy-free granola or oats + nuts mix over the berries.

6

Repeat the layers once more: yogurt, then berries, and ending with granola on the top.

7

Drizzle a final touch of honey on top for added sweetness, if desired. Chill in the refrigerator for 5-10 minutes before serving for a refreshing treat.
